Transaction

4e8be8719bf29680026e88ba8d136dd64d894efa14c79c9891946bbd056fc0c5
271,422 confirmations
Timestamp
1613088334
Block670,191
Fee25,795 sats
Fee rate181.7 sats/vB
view on mempool.space

Inputs & Outputs